A line is a one-dimensional figure having no thickness and extends infinitely in both the directions.
Intersecting lines are the lines which intersect at one point.
Parallel lines which do not intersect at any point.
An angle is formed by two rays meeting at a common end point.
Vertically opposite angles are the angles formed opposite to one another at the intersection of two lines.
Vertically opposite angles are always equal.

Answer:
The scale factor is 2/3.
Step-by-step explanation:
Given data,
The given image is (6,9)
The image after dilation is (4,6)
The scale factor is calculated by dividing the resultant image by the initial image.
For example, if the initial dimensions are (x1, y1) and the final dimensions are (x2,y2). The scale factor is calculated using x2/x1 = y2/y1 = Scale Factor
In our scenario,
x1 = 6
x2 = 4
y1 = 9
y2 = 6
Scale Factor = x2/x1
=> 4/6
=> 2/3
Similarly for y axis,
Scale Factor = y2/y1
=> 6/9
=> 2/3
Therefore, the scale factor is 2/3.
